Output 03f176d3ede6917923df968cebfeb3e2eedaeba6d7ec20d4f9746d517618172e:0

value
614970
script pubkey
OP_0 OP_PUSHBYTES_20 e6c1576e906205cebf773769ffe0fbbc060dc75e
address
bc1qumq4wm5svgzua0mhxa5llc8mhsrqm367z064wu
transaction
03f176d3ede6917923df968cebfeb3e2eedaeba6d7ec20d4f9746d517618172e
confirmations
206461
spent
true